A growing marketing agency in Leeds is looking for a Senior Account Manager to join their team. You'll be managing the day-to-day delivery of campaigns, ensuring that work is quoted for accurately, strategically correct, on brief, on time and on budget. They are at the forefront of innovative marketing strategies and creative campaigns. They have a diverse portfolio of clients and a dedicated team of marketing and branding professionals to bring them to life!

Responsibilities:

  • Lead the execution of marketing campaigns, ensuring they meet clients' expectations and objectives.
  • Regularly communicate with clients to provide updates and give feedback.
  • Manage project timelines, budgets, and resources to ensure successful campaign delivery.
  • Work closely with internal teams to develop and implement strategies.
  • Identify opportunities to upsell additional services and retain clients.
  • Provide exceptional customer service, responding to client inquiries and resolving issues.

What they're looking for:

  • Proven experience in account management or a related role within a marketing agency.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Strong project management abilities.
  • Creative problem-solving skills.
  • Understanding of marketing strategies and industry trends.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office and project management software.

What they can offer you:

  • Competitive salary and performance-based bonuses.
  • Opportunities for professional growth and development.
  • Collaborative and creative work environment.
  • Work with a diverse portfolio of clients in various industries.
  • Be part of a dynamic and innovative team in the heart of Leeds.
